Transforming Learning Environments with Intelligent Tutoring Systems

In recent years, the integration of Intelligent Tutoring Systems (ITS) into educational settings has revolutionized the way students engage with learning materials. These systems leverage artificial intelligence to provide personalized instruction, adapting to the unique needs and learning styles of each student. By analyzing a learner’s progress in real-time, ITS can identify areas of strength and weakness, allowing for targeted interventions that enhance understanding and retention.

One of the most significant advantages of ITS is their ability to offer immediate feedback. Unlike conventional classroom settings, where students may wait days for assessments, intelligent tutoring systems provide instant evaluations. This rapid response not only keeps students motivated but also helps them correct misconceptions before they become ingrained. The result is a more dynamic learning experience that fosters a deeper comprehension of the subject matter.

Moreover, ITS can cater to diverse learning environments, whether in a classroom, at home, or in hybrid models. They can support a wide range of subjects, from mathematics to language arts, making them versatile tools for educators. By incorporating gamification elements and interactive content, these systems engage students in ways that traditional methods often cannot. This engagement is crucial in maintaining interest and encouraging a lifelong love of learning.

as educational institutions increasingly adopt these technologies, the potential for data-driven insights becomes apparent.Educators can analyze aggregated data from ITS to identify trends and patterns in student performance across different demographics. This data can inform curriculum development and teaching strategies, ultimately leading to improved educational outcomes. By harnessing the power of intelligent tutoring systems, the future of education looks promising, paving the way for a more personalized and effective learning journey for every student.

Bridging Accessibility Gaps in Education through Innovative technologies

In recent years, the landscape of education has been transformed by the integration of innovative technologies, particularly artificial intelligence. These advancements are not only enhancing learning experiences but also addressing critical accessibility gaps that have long hindered students with disabilities. By leveraging AI, educators can create personalized learning environments that cater to the unique needs of each student, ensuring that everyone has the opportunity to thrive.

One of the most significant contributions of AI in education is the development of adaptive learning platforms. These systems analyze individual student performance in real-time, adjusting the curriculum to match their learning pace and style. This personalized approach is especially beneficial for students with learning disabilities, as it allows them to engage with material in a way that suits their needs. Features such as:

  • Speech recognition: Enabling students with physical disabilities to interact with educational content.
  • Text-to-speech technology: Assisting visually impaired learners by converting written material into audio.
  • predictive analytics: Identifying students at risk of falling behind and providing timely interventions.

Moreover, AI-powered tools are breaking down language barriers, making education more inclusive for non-native english speakers. Intelligent translation applications can provide real-time translations of classroom materials, allowing students to participate fully in discussions and activities. This not only fosters a more diverse learning environment but also promotes cultural exchange and understanding among peers. By utilizing these technologies, educators can ensure that language differences do not impede a student’s ability to succeed.

the use of virtual and augmented reality in education is revolutionizing how students with disabilities access learning experiences. these immersive technologies can simulate real-world scenarios, providing hands-on learning opportunities that may not be feasible in traditional classroom settings. As a notable example, students with mobility challenges can explore past sites or conduct science experiments in a virtual environment, enhancing their engagement and understanding. As these technologies continue to evolve, they hold the promise of creating a more equitable educational landscape for all learners.

  4. What are the potential challenges of integrating AI in education?

    While AI offers numerous benefits, there are challenges to consider, such as:

    • Ensuring data privacy and security for students.
    • Addressing the digital divide and ensuring equitable access to technology.
    • Training educators to effectively use AI tools in their teaching practices.
